Imagine being in a building that usually would be full of calm, normalcy, and work. But what if it was all a trap. What if the more you tried to survive, the environment around you toys with your emotions and well being? The time is the early 20th century, just after the Spanish Flu epidemic. The building that you are in, just happens to be built by the head of a mysterious cult? But the day everyone was looking forward to of being completed and opened, turned out to be an invitation for something more.

Features include:

  • High-quality graphics: Hinge provides players with a plethora of state-of-the-art visual effects.
  • Immersive storytelling: Our game tears down the fourth wall, allowing the audience to be directly involved in Hinge’s story.
  • Terrifying atmosphere: We experimented with some of the scariest and most intense horror scenes in existence and were brave enough to use them in our game.
  • Twisted plot: Hinge’s nonlinear narrative is breathtaking to explore.
  • Physics-based interactions: The game is filled with puzzles with extraordinary solutions and interesting gameplay mechanics that give the player freedom of choice.
  • Art-horror: Colorful, provocative characters and detailed authenticity of the beginning of the last century.

What happens when the oppressive atmosphere of horror chases you everywhere you go? What if survival is not enough? When you hear that fear, how will it play with your mind? Find out when HINGE: Episode 1 comes to Steam on November 27, 2020, and also coming to the Oculus Store.
